Output 44c2d8b6a802c3d6d6a2a5ca3387aae979f2793ad8881a525ec1ef7c18f14015:3

value
68500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f79dedc75dcbcf58c55c331feb2fcb136b8151 OP_EQUAL
address
MTQWo1oDk7d5fATUgdzKmMwnQELqefnZy6
transaction
44c2d8b6a802c3d6d6a2a5ca3387aae979f2793ad8881a525ec1ef7c18f14015
spent
true